What is imprinted concrete?

Imprinted concrete is a decorative driveway surface where freshly poured, coloured concrete is stamped with patterned mats before it sets — creating the look of natural stone, brick, slate or cobbles in a single continuous surface with no weeds, no joints to weaken, and no blocks to sink.

When properly laid and sealed, it gives you all the visual character of traditional paving with none of the maintenance headaches. It's been one of the most popular driveway choices across the North West for twenty years, and the material and technique have only got better.

Our Process

How a proper imprinted concrete
driveway gets made.

Every job follows the same six-step process. Skipping stages is where most failed driveways come from — so we don't.

01

Free Site Survey

We visit, measure up, check drainage and sub-base conditions, and discuss patterns and colours with you. No obligation, no cost.

02

Fixed-Price Quote

Detailed written quote with itemised pricing. What you see is what you pay — no surprise extras mid-project.

03

Excavation & Sub-Base

Excavate to proper depth, lay compacted MOT Type 1 sub-base, form edges and drainage falls. The bit that matters most.

04

Concrete Pour

Driveway-grade concrete reinforced with steel mesh or fibres, power-floated smooth ready for the colour hardener.

05

Pattern Stamped

Colour hardener applied, release agent dusted on, pattern mats stamped into the surface before it sets. One-chance-only work.

06

Sealed & Finished

After curing, surface is washed, acid-etched if needed, and sealed with UV-stable sealant. Drive on it 24 hours later.

How long does imprinted concrete last?

Professionally installed imprinted concrete typically lasts 25-30 years with proper maintenance. Resealing every 3-5 years keeps it looking fresh and protects against UV and water damage.

Is imprinted concrete slippery when wet?

When properly sealed with an anti-slip additive in the final sealer, imprinted concrete offers good traction even when wet. The textured pattern surface also naturally improves grip over smooth surfaces.

Can imprinted concrete be repaired if it cracks?

Yes — small cracks can be repaired and the surface can be re-sealed or even re-coloured as part of ongoing maintenance. For larger areas, full resurfacing is possible without re-pouring.

How long does installation take?

A typical residential driveway takes 5-10 working days from first excavation to sealed finish, weather dependent. We'll give you a specific timeline with your quote.

Do I need planning permission?

Usually not for a permeable or re-directed-drainage driveway under 5m². For larger driveways you may need to ensure compliance with SuDS (Sustainable Drainage Systems) regulations — we handle that as part of the design.

When can I drive on it?

Foot traffic is fine after 24 hours. We recommend waiting 5-7 days before driving a car on it, and 2-3 weeks before any heavy loads (builders' merchant deliveries, skip lorries, etc.).
